1.First of all, open your Photoshop. Click File > New. Set the Image size (it's up to you)
2.The second one, use Paint Bucket Tool to fill the image with black (make sure the foreground is black).
3.Then, use Horizontal Type Tool to give a text (the text is white). You also can add Warp Text to your text (it's up to you).
4.Now, click Image > Rotate Canvas > 90' CW
5. Click Filter > Stylize > Wind. The Method, choose Wind. The Direction, choose from the left. Ok.
6. One more time. Click Filter > Wind, or you just can press Ctrl + F.
7. After that, Click Filter > Stylize > Diffuse. Set Mode into Normal.
8. Click Filter > Distort > Ripple. Set Amount into 90% and Size is small.
9. Next, Click Filter > Blur > Gaussian Blur. Set Radius into 1,5 pixels.
10. Rotate Canvas into 90' CCW (almost similar to the 4th step).
11. Click Image > Mode > Grayscale. If any notice like this, click Flatten.
12. Click Image > Mode > Indexed Color.
13. Last One, Click Image > Mode > Color Table. Set the Table into Black Body. Click Ok.
